Job Title: System Test Analyst

Location: Leeds

Salary: Up to £35,000 + 3% flexible benefits + on target bonus of 5% + contributory pension

The client's personal approach is why they’ve been awarded an Exceptional 3 star rating by Investor in Customers for the last two years. As a technology solutions provider, this is testament to their excellent levels of customer service coupled with their care and management of their own in-house employees. This role is working within an Agile, SCRUM / RAD team and will give you the chance to further your experience with these methodologies.

You’ll be responsible for:
  1. Test script creation and execution.
  2. Liaise with Business Analysts to ensure test coverage of functional requirements.
  3. Defect investigation & logging where expected outcomes are different from actual.
  4. Develop and maintain an in-depth knowledge of the core Collections system and processes, and how those systems and processes interact.
  5. Perform System Integration and End to End testing.
  6. Develop skills required for the production of estimates and risk analysis (where required).
  7. Attend/lead document walkthroughs and reviews of project documentation when required from a testing perspective.
  8. Consistently communicate risks and issues to the project team and/or Product Test Manager.
  9. Define and document the test strategy per project, ensuring a robust test pack is in place to support the test execution.
You’ll need to evidence the following qualifications, skills and experience:
Experience
  1. At least 3 years system testing experience
  2. Ideally have a background in software testing or IT
  3. Exposure to .NET and Microsoft SQL Server 2010 and beyond
  4. Experience of working with test automation tools such as Selenium and SOAPUI
  5. Understanding of different testing approaches and techniques
  6. Agile, SCRUM or RAD experience
  7. Experience of working within the constructs of Team Foundation Server 2013 and above
  8. Knowledge of working with test management tools such as Microsoft Test Manager 2013
  9. Financial services/debt collection experience
  10. Business project management experience
Qualifications
  1. ISTQB Foundation in Software Testing as a minimum
Skills
  1. Strong technical testing skills
  2. Sound understanding of System Integration Testing
  3. Ability to query databases
  4. Diagnostic and problem solving
  5. Understanding of web-based applications
  6. Understanding of Service Oriented Architecture
  7. Knowledge of networking and system architecture
  8. Systems applications awareness – SQL, TFS, Microsoft .NET
  9. Strong problem solving and analytical skills
  10. Process Driven
  11. High attention to detail
  12. Professional approach
  13. Ability to influence others
  14. Excellent team player
  15. Highly self-motivated
  16. Strong communicator
  17. Assertive and persuasive
